The Importance of Cardiovascular Health

Cardiovascular health plays a crucial role in overall well-being. A healthy heart contributes to a longer, more active life and reduces the risk of serious conditions like stroke and heart attack. Most cardiovascular diseases are preventable through lifestyle changes.

Risk Factors for Cardiovascular Disease

High blood pressure: High blood pressure increases the strain on the heart and blood vessels.
High cholesterol: High cholesterol contributes to plaque buildup in arteries, leading to blockages.
Diabetes: High blood sugar damages blood vessels and increases the risk of heart disease.
Smoking: Smoking narrows blood vessels, raises blood pressure, and increases heart rate.
Physical inactivity: Lack of physical activity increases the risk of obesity, high blood pressure, and high cholesterol.
Obesity: Obesity increases the risk of many cardiovascular diseases.
Unhealthy lifestyle: Poor diet and excessive alcohol consumption are significant risk factors.

How to Improve Cardiovascular Health

Healthy Diet

Eat plenty of fruits, vegetables, whole grains, fish, and nuts. Reduce your intake of saturated fats, trans fats, sugar, and salt. Drink plenty of water.

Regular Exercise

Aim for at least 30 minutes of moderate-intensity exercise most days of the week. Choose activities you enjoy, such as walking, running, swimming, or cycling.

Weight Management

Maintain a healthy weight through a combination of healthy eating and regular exercise.

Blood Pressure and Cholesterol Control

Get your blood pressure and cholesterol checked regularly. Take medication as prescribed by your doctor if necessary.

Don’t Smoke

Smoking is one of the leading risk factors for heart disease. Quit smoking to protect your cardiovascular health.

Stress Reduction

Stress can negatively impact cardiovascular health. Find ways to manage stress, such as meditation, yoga, or listening to relaxing music.
